§ 502.404. OPERATION OF VEHICLE WITHOUT LICENSE PLATE OR
REGISTRATION INSIGNIA. (a) A person commits an offense if the person operates on a public highway during a registration period a passenger car or commercial motor vehicle that does not display two license plates, at the front and rear of the vehicle...

The exact wording of the law is that it must be displayed at the front (and rear) of the vehicle.
Bottom line: if you don't have it mounted at the front of the car (where it should be) you can be pulled over and ticketed. Whether the ticket stands will be up to the judge.
